Omicron variant cases confirmed in Bangladesh women's cricket team after returning from Zimbabwe tour
India Today
Without revealing the identity of the cricketers, Bangladesh Health Minister Zahid Maleque said, the two players are the first confirmed cases of the Omicron variant of the coronavirus in the country.
Bangladesh has confirmed the presence of Omicron variant of the coronavirus in two players of the women’s national cricket team, which recently returned from Zimbabwe.
“Both the cricketers are in quarantine at a hotel. They are in good health,” Health Minister Zahid Maleque told reporters here late Saturday evening.
